Manage Meet Me Conferencing with AT&T Collaborate

With the Meet Me Conferencing feature, available with the Unified Communications (UC) bundle, users can invite participants to a meeting bridge with audio and video. When used together with the AT&T Collaborate app’s My Room function, you can change a group chat session to a group audio call. (See About the Collaborate app.)

As an administrator, you manage the bridge of a meeting. By default, all users who have the Collaborate app with UC features are assigned as hosts to the site’s bridge. Hosts can schedule or start calls without a reservation. You can edit profile settings, view meeting hosts, and manage call handling features for the site’s bridge.

Manage profiles

A profile includes basic information, such as the phone number, name, and time zone of the conference bridge. First, access the bridge. Then, update the profile.

Select profile settings

  1. On the Collaborate homepage, click Switch sites or Select a site, select a site to manage, and then click Save.
  2. On the left menu, expand Call handling, and then click Meet Me Conferencing. The Manage Meet Me Conferencing page appears.
  3. Next to the site bridge that you want to manage, click the Edit icon. The manage page for that bridge appears.
  4. Click Profile, and then make any changes that you want to the name, phone number, extension, department, time zone, and limit on the number of participants.
  5. Scroll down to the Privacy section and select privacy settings.
  6. Click Save.

View meeting hosts

Meeting hosts can schedule calls or start calls without a reservation. Certain features, such as the ability to mute participants, are available only to hosts. By default, all users who have the Collaborate app with unified communications features are assigned as hosts. You can view hosts, but you can’t add or remove them.

View hosts on a site’s bridge

  1. Follow steps 1-3 under Select profile settings.
  2. Click Hosts. The Meet Me Conferencing hosts page appears.
  3. From the Search by menu, select the search criteria. For example, select Last name.
  4. In the Search field, enter information that corresponds to the criteria you selected in step 3. For example, enter Jones.
  5. Click the Search icon. A list of all site hosts who match your search criteria appears.

Manage call handling features

To manage call handling features, you first assign the feature to a bridge, and then you manage the specific feature.

Assign features

  1. Follow steps 1 and 2 under Select profile settings.
  2. On the Manage Meet Me Conferencing page to the right of the meeting you want to manage, click the Edit icon. The manage page for that meeting appears.
  3. Click Calling features, and then under Set call features, click Assign features.
  4. Check the box next to the features you want to assign, and then click Assign.
  5. To set up each feature, in the section for the feature, click Set up or Edit, and then follow the prompts.
  6. When you’re finished, click Save.
